Job Title: Social Media Manager

Job Description:

Huge is looking for an energetic, creative and data-driven Social Media Manager to join our Marketing team at an exciting time of transition. In this role, you will manage all aspects of social media campaigns, from conception and design to development and implementation. 

What You'll Be Doing:

  • Develop the social media strategy with creative content and campaign ideas tailored to each social media channel that supports our marketing and growth plan
  • Content creation and curation, including visuals, written posts and videos, tailored to each platform  
  • Collaborate closely with creative teams, craft teams and the wider marketing team to create content and campaigns that drive demand generation
  • Define KPIs for social media campaigns, measure and report on performance and optimize for success
  • Lead social engagement cross-platform with our clients, the wider community and our followers
  • Leading and managing the social media calendar as part of the wider marketing team calendar 
  • Communicate the strategy and execution of all social activity effectively to internal stakeholders including senior management

What We'd Like to See:

  • 3+ years of experience managing social campaigns with some B2B experience
  • Experience in a digital agency or consulting environment would be a bonus but it’s more important for us that you have experience with great brands whatever the sector
  • Demonstrated experience in driving engagement and community growth 
  • Strong understanding of paid social and organic content and their roles in the marketing mix 
  • Creative flair and exceptional analytical skills to interpret data, derive insights and drive data-driven decision-making
  • Exceptional written and visual communication skills and an ability to craft content that tells a story voice and connects with the intended audience
  • A natural relationship-builder, able to influence and inspire the wider team
  • Solid cross-functional collaboration skills with the ability to build consensus among teams
  • Knowledge of best practices for social media platforms such as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n, Discord, Pinterest, with a passion for evaluating and using cutting edge technologies and platforms 

About Huge

Huge is a creative consultancy powered by human and AI collaboration. We partner with the world’s most ambitious brands to Make Huge Moves, which are creative solutions that deliver powerful outcomes. Huge helps clients unlock meaningful growth in areas ranging from AI business consulting, brand and customer experience, technology advisory, and strategy, to high-value audience analysis and product innovation. Founded in 1999 in Brooklyn, NY, Huge has more than 1,200 employees working across North America, Europe, Asia, and Latin America. The consultancy is part of the Interpublic Group of Companies.
